### 2. Apply Server Component Patterns

**Async Component Structure**:

- Use async arrow functions or async function declarations
- Add `import 'server-only'` guard for server-only code
- Fetch data through facades with caching
- Use Promise.all for parallel data fetching

**Authentication**:

- Use `getUserIdAsync()` for optional user auth
- Use `getRequiredUserIdAsync()` for required user auth (redirect if unauthenticated or user not found)
- Use `checkIsOwnerAsync()` for ownership checks

**Streaming with Suspense**:

- Wrap async children in `<Suspense fallback={<Skeleton />}>`
- Create corresponding skeleton components
- Use error boundaries for resilience

**Metadata Generation**:

- Export `generateMetadata` for pages
- Use `generatePageMetadata()` utility
- Include JSON-LD structured data

**ISR Configuration**:

- Export `revalidate` constant when appropriate

## Component Naming Conventions

- `*Async` suffix for async data-fetching components
- `*Server` suffix for server-only orchestration
- `*Skeleton` suffix for loading states
